Transaction e0a396cf77911d0748f995703ccc6c061e0758756fedb18f4d45d7b3cacbc08a
1 Input
1 Output
-
e0a396cf77911d0748f995703ccc6c061e0758756fedb18f4d45d7b3cacbc08a:0
- value
- 171784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c5745a459c797fbde7d1cca07cbf48a92267ed1 OP_EQUAL
- address
- 37C51padB9xE9cn69jgZEzLE7WW4awZiqQ